On Thu, 06 Dec 2001, Daniel Stodden wrote:

> over the last few days, i've been experiencing lengthy syslog
> complaints like the following:
>
> Dec 6 06:33:42 bitch kernel: hdc: dma_intr: status=0x51 { DriveReady
> SeekComplete Error }
> Dec 6 06:33:42 bitch kernel: hdc: dma_intr: error=0x40 {
> UncorrectableError }, LBAsect=1753708, sector=188216

> my main question is whether this could be a kernel problem or whether
> i just need to hurry a little getting my backups up to date and think
> about a new disk.

1. Get your backup done quickly, as long as the drive lasts.

2. Run IBM's drive fitness test. DO NOT USE "ERASE DISK" (low level
format) features, no matter what IBM may say, check the
German-Language DTLA FAQ: http://www.cooling-solutions.de/dtla-faq/
Write down the technical result code. Also check Anandtech's FAQ
(English language): http://www.anandtech.com/guides/viewfaq.html?i=71
